Albert Willemetz

Albert Willemetz (14 February 1887 – 7 October 1964) was a French librettist.

Birth and Death Data: Born 1887 (Paris), Died October 7, 1964 (Marnes-la-Coquette)

Date Range of DAHR Recordings: 1921 - 1942

Roles Represented in DAHR: lyricist, translator, librettist, adapter, composer
